DC under heat with SM Superfruit Masque for 30min. I put my DiY Hair Growth oil on top. This oil is so smooth feeling.

I kept it simple Grapeseed, EVOO, JBCO, very little coconut, Lavender, Peppermint, Vetiver, Ylang Ylang infused with fenugreek and hibiscus. I think the hibiscus and Vetiver gave this oil the nice smooth feeling. This mix was a hit.

Deep conditioned yesterday with L’Oreal Nature’s Therapy DC. This time I added Canola oil and microwaved it for about 45 seconds. It left my hair feeling juicy and smooth! Actually moisturized. I am glad I revisited the product. I would repurchase it since you get 16 oz for about $12 on Amazon. But I would prefer a conditioner that does not need to be doctored up.
